Break and enter

On November 25, 2014 at 10:34 p.m., the Guelph Police went to a Hales Crescent home to investigate a break and enter. The resident returned home to find the front door open and a male inside. The male left the area on foot when he was confronted by the resident. Two other residents had been home at the time but did not hear or see anything. A theft of electronics is reported.

The male is described as having dark skin, in his early 20’s, approximately 5’9” with thicker eyebrows. He was wearing a black hoody. It is believed that he may have gotten into a white or grey small car.
